South Beach Steak Diane
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 10 Minutes
Cook Time: 10 Minutes
Ready In: 20 Minutes
Servings: 4
This main meat dish is so flavorful and delicious; you can serve this to your family or dinner guests who won't guess that they are eating a recipe out of a diet cookbook. This recipe can be eaten during Phase 1 of the diet. Recipe courtesy of the South Beach Diet Cookbook.
Ingredients:
4 (3 ounce) beef tenderloin, about
5 tablespoons trans free margarine, i use smart balance
1/4 cup onion, minced
1/4 cup mushroom, sliced
1/2 teaspoon garlic, minced
1 tablespoon worcestershire sauce
1 teaspoon mustard powder
2 tablespoons lemon juice
1 tablespoon dried parsley
fresh chives (to garnish) (optional)
salt
pepper
Directions:
1. Place each 3 oz piece of tenderloin between wax paper and pound with a mallet until the steak is about 1/2 inch thick.
2. Pat meat with paper towel to dry; season with salt and pepper.
3. In a large skillet, melt 3 Tbsp of the margarine and cook meat on medium to high heat for 2 minutes on each side.
4. Remove the meat from skillet onto a plate and keep warm.
5. In the same skillet, melt 2 Tbsp of margarine and saute the mushrooms, onion and garlic until veggies are semi-soft.
6. Add the mustard powder and Worcestershire, mixing well.
7. Add the meat to skillet and cook until meat is done to your liking.
8. Remove the meat and keep warm; combine lemon juice and parsley in the skillet and cook until warmed.
9. Pour sauce over the meat and garnish with chives; serve.
